Where Kids and Families are Always First

MultiCare Mary Bridge Children's Hospital is the state-designated Level II Pediatric Trauma Center and the only pediatric hospital in Washington's South Sound Region dedicated to a comprehensive network of health services for children and adolescents. Our vision is to be the highest quality and safest place for children to receive care, where every child has a medical home and is supported by nationally recognized services and experience. Mary Bridge Children's multi-disciplinary approach to care includes pediatric experts for emergency services, inpatient care, and outpatient specialty clinics, all specializing in kids and their unique needs.

FTE: 1.0 Shift: Variable Schedule: Variable

Compensation is based on Years of Experience and ranges from $428K-$470K as a 1.0 FTE.

Position Summary

MultiCare Mary Bridge Children's is seeking a board eligible/board certified Pediatric Cardiologist with cardiac imaging expertise to join our well-established, thriving and comprehensive group practice in Washington. This position includes work in the Children's Hospital along with outpatient clinics. Providers at MultiCare are recognized as being among the best in the Northwest Region. Here, you'll find everything you need to excel in your job including outstanding facilities, comprehensive resources and talented teammates in partnering for healing and a healthy future.

Responsibilities

  • Physician shall evaluate, treat and provide follow up care to patients as assigned by the Heart Center including providing medical and cardiac imaging management of pediatric and adult congenital patients that will include:
  • OR TTE and TEE coverage
  • Cardiac CT/MRI
  • Fetal echocardiogram
  • The Physician shall devote such time as may be reasonably necessary to cooperate with the efforts of the Heart Center in the management and governance of Heart Center activities
  • Physician shall exercise best efforts to keep Physician's skills and knowledge current with the best up to date practice in the Physician's field of practice by study of current medical literature and continuing medical education courses (CME)

Requirements

  • Graduate of an accredited medical school (MD or DO)
  • Licensure to practice medicine in Washington State as a Physician
  • Board eligible/board certified in Pediatric Cardiology at time of employment with additional advanced cardiac imaging training
  • DEA, NPI & prescriptive authority
  • Current BLS for Healthcare Providers certification by the American Heart Association
